Transaction 7605d5dac855811e18f65b27c0ba13c390b02bce2e1a990975769e00d373f916
1 Input
1 Output
-
7605d5dac855811e18f65b27c0ba13c390b02bce2e1a990975769e00d373f916:0
- value
- 8829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 faff786edb476e8ab1dd0ecd378ff9af1116a142 OP_EQUAL
- address
- 3QaAtu5tdSsvzELYiy6U57vd6Yrdu5h3CW